>  기사  >  웹 프론트엔드  >  html5의 숨겨진 부울 속성

html5의 숨겨진 부울 속성

黄舟
黄舟원래의
2017-11-03 11:45:312829검색

숨겨진 단락:

<p hidden>这个段落应该被隐藏。</p>

브라우저 지원


IE

Firefox

Chrome

Safari

Opera

모든 주요 브라우저는 숨겨진 속성을 지원합니다. Internet Explorer 제외.

정의 및 사용법

hidden 속성은 부울 속성입니다.

이 속성이 설정되면 요소가 여전히 관련이 있거나 더 이상 관련이 없음을 지정합니다.

브라우저는 숨겨진 속성이 지정된 요소를 표시해서는 안 됩니다.

hidden 속성을 사용하면 특정 조건이 일치할 때까지(예: 특정 체크박스 선택) 사용자가 요소를 볼 수 없도록 할 수도 있습니다. 그런 다음 JavaScript 숨겨진 속성을 제거하여 이 요소를 표시할 수 있습니다.

HTML 4.01과 HTML5의 차이점

hidden 속성은 HTML5의 새로운 기능입니다.

HTML과 XHTML의 차이점

XHTML에서는 속성 약어가 금지되며 숨겨진 속성은 d813d95ed3c44b2e841fd3e3921ea971으로 정의되어야 합니다.

Syntax

<element hidden>

HTML5는 자리 표시자, 다운로드, 자동 초점 등 매우 간단하면서도 강력한

HTML 속성을 많이 제공합니다. 또 다른 새로운 속성은 숨겨진 속성입니다. 웹 페이지 요소에 숨겨진 속성이 있으면 해당 동작은 CSS의 display: none;과 매우 유사합니다. 요소는 페이지 공간을 차지하지 않고 사라집니다. 작성 방법은 매우 간단합니다.

<div hidden>
	You can&#39;t see me!</div>

오래된 브라우저를 사용하고 있고 이 속성을 지원하지 않는 경우 CSS에 다음 코드를 추가하여 지원하면 됩니다.

*[hidden] { display: none; }

그렇다면 숨겨진 속성을 사용하는 이유는 무엇일까요? 의미상 더 의미가 있고 코드의 가독성이 향상된다는 의미입니다. 그리고 CSS의 display:none과 비교하면 문자 그대로 더 간단합니다!


위 내용은 html5의 숨겨진 부울 속성의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.